Sproutline scheduler builds fail at the secrets-scan stage. Cause: test fixtures embed a fake pump-controller credential that trips the scanner. Fixtures are inert — no live endpoints. Allowlisting the fixture path unblocks the pipeline; change is in review. No production credentials touched. Verify against the pipeline run carrying the token below.

trace token, kahog-tajeg: htk6_97d963

Ticket: Export job for Tallygrove spreadsheets failed its signature check after last night's build. Context for newcomers: the exporter streams rows to keep memory under 512 MB, and the streamed artifact gets signed at the end. The signer used a stale key after Friday's rotation, so verification rejected it. Re-sign the artifact with the current key shown below.

deploy key for kajof-fajop: bky6_gDHw9Q

Item 7 — Relevance tuning notes escrow (Harwick Search). Confirm the quarter's tuning notes for the Ostrel ranker are sealed into the ceremony vault before key rotation. Two witnesses from the eng sync must sign the manifest. Verify the vault copy opens cleanly on the air-gapped reader. Opening the sealed archive during verification requires the recovery passphrase given below.

vault phrase of bagaf-kajeg = jorath-feniel-briir-siliel-ralix

FINANCE REVIEW SUMMARY — Heads of Department

The Grenholt factory expansion is approved in principle. Capacity rises forty percent; payback modelled at under three years. Capital draw begins next quarter, funded from reserves, not new debt. Tooling orders proceed once procurement confirms lead times. The strategic assumptions underpinning this decision are recorded in the confidential note below.

board note of bawep-tajef: Queniusek Systems plans to raise the Quenvan list price by 53.1 percent in March. The pricing group signed off on a budget of $176.4 million for Project Drueth. The renewal with Casionix Partners closes at $142.5 million a year, 8.3 percent below the last contract. Project Fraax slips by six weeks because of the tooling delay.